Although individual rare diseases affect relatively small patient populations, their overall impact is far greater than many people realize. More than 7,000 rare diseases have been identified worldwide, collectively affecting an estimated 300–400 million people. In China alone, over 20 million people are living with rare diseases, with approximately 200,000 new cases diagnosed each year.
To strengthen the rare disease diagnosis and treatment system, China's National Health Commission and four other government agencies jointly released the First National Rare Disease Catalog in 2018, covering 121 diseases. Following the publication of the Second National Rare Disease Catalog in 2023, the total number of listed diseases expanded to 207, providing an important foundation for drug development, regulatory approval, reimbursement inclusion, and clinical application.
In recent years, China has continued to improve its rare disease policy framework. Mechanisms such as dynamic National Reimbursement Drug List (NRDL) updates, expedited review pathways, conditional approvals, temporary importation programs, and the Hainan Boao Lecheng International Medical Tourism Pilot Zone have significantly enhanced patient access to innovative therapies.
By the end of 2024, approximately 126 rare disease treatment drugs had been included in China's NRDL, covering 68 rare diseases. In 2024 alone, 13 new rare disease indications were added, including therapies for Homozygous Familial Hypercholesterolemia (HoFH), Idiopathic Pulmonary Arterial Hypertension (IPAH), and other conditions.
Meanwhile, China's National Medical Products Administration (NMPA) has continued to accelerate approvals of rare disease therapies. In 2025, a total of 48 rare disease-related products received approval. Between 2020 and 2025, nearly 190 rare disease therapies were approved for marketing, indicating that China's rare disease drug supply system has entered a period of rapid expansion.
Procurement data from healthcare institutions indicate a significant increase in demand for rare disease medications.
Publicly available data show that between 2017 and 2019, the procurement volume of rare disease drugs in Chinese healthcare institutions, measured in Defined Daily Doses (DDDs), increased continuously. In 2018, procurement volume grew by 571.56% year-over-year, while procurement expenditure increased by 45.22%.
Notably, although some high-cost orphan drugs account for a substantial share of procurement spending, patient coverage rates remain below 5%, and in some cases even below 1%, highlighting considerable unmet medical needs within the market.
The global orphan drug market has become one of the fastest-growing segments within the pharmaceutical industry.
Industry forecasts estimate that:
● The global orphan drug market exceeded USD 220 billion in 2024;
● The market is expected to surpass USD 400 billion by 2030;
● The compound annual growth rate (CAGR) is projected to remain above 10%.
China's orphan drug market is also experiencing rapid growth.
Supported by favorable policies, breakthroughs in domestic innovation, and improved reimbursement capabilities, China's rare disease drug market is expected to exceed RMB 100 billion before 2030, making it one of the most promising growth markets globally.
Despite continuous expansion of reimbursement coverage, most rare disease therapies remain high-cost treatments, with annual patient expenses ranging from tens of thousands to several million yuan.
China's reimbursement ecosystem is gradually evolving into a multi-layered payment structure comprising:
● National Health Insurance
● Catastrophic Medical Insurance
● Medical Assistance Programs
● Inclusive Supplemental Insurance Programs
● Patient Assistance Programs (PAPs)
● Commercial Health Insurance
However, challenges such as insufficient hospital stocking, inconsistent implementation of dual-channel reimbursement mechanisms, and regional disparities in reimbursement policies persist, creating significant opportunities for specialized pharmaceutical supply chain services.
